The main requirements of the role (but not limited to):
Provide support in continuous improvement of food safety and quality systems (and all related documentation), food safety, food defence to meet the customers and third-party audit standards
Assist the Technical Manager in implementation and improvement of Quality and Food Safety policies and procedures set by business and provide support for the development and continuous improvement of these policies. Ensuring they are reviewed, kept up to date and implemented accordingly.
Stepping up in the absence of our Technical Manager during annual leave.
Responsible for conducting customer's standards/code of practice Gap Analys.
Identify gaps in internal standards within the business operations.
Assist in updating internal procedures and policies to ensure compliance with customer standards and meets with all current food legislation
Identify gaps and support with compliance with BRCGS Food Safety.
Responsible for conducting and keeping Risk Assessments up to date.
Assist with checking and approving artwork.
Undertake project work as directed by the Technical Manager.
Plan and carry out process audits to verify output from accountabilities
Contribute to customer and third-party audits and ensure compliance with quality management procedures related to food safety and food safety culture.
Conducting system internal audits and closing out non-conformances.
Deputise as appropriate for the Technical Manager during absence / holidays, including leading incident / Crisis management if required.
Any other reasonable management requests to meet the needs of the business.
The successful candidate:
will hold a degree in a food related subject.
hold a minimum of 3 years' experience within the food industry - ideally manufacturing.
previous experience of managing BRCGS and multiple retailer standards.
